Description

Sherman Jameson built this house next to the Jameson & Wotton Wharf to be used by his family members in the mid 1920s. Jameson's sisters made ice cream and pies to sell to passengers as they disembarked from the steamboat that brought them to Friendship. The proceeds from sales were used to pay educational expenses for Sherman Jameson's son and nephews.
